Bitzero Holdings (OTC: BTZRF) acquired eight NVIDIA Blackwell B300 servers (64 GPUs) to deploy at its low-carbon Namsskogan, Norway data center in partnership with Hydra Host.
The deployment is expected to be completed in Q1 2026 and marks Bitzero's first direct investment in GPU compute hardware and its entry into neocloud operations. The servers will be leased as bare-metal infrastructure for AI workloads via Hydra Host's Brokkr platform, which will provide provisioning, monitoring, and access to Hydra Host's global customer network.
The pilot aims to validate GPU operations on Bitzero's infrastructure and establish an operational framework for potential future expansion, with revenue scaling tied to demand and pilot results.
